Domanda

E 'possibile simulare le forze personalizzati (nel mio caso, elettromagnetica) utilizzando l'API di SolidWorks Animator per / Studio del movimento / COSMOS / EMS?

sto cercando qualsiasi combinazione di API che espongono i dati necessari per essere in grado di simulare le dinamica di una a nord positivo / negativo o su supporto magnetico / sud forze elettriche .

le basi di quello che ho bisogno di essere in grado di fare è:

  • modello a due cubetti
  • Segna un punto su uno come avente carica positiva e il punto sull'altra come carica negativa (o nord / sud magnetismo)
  • Premere il tasto "Go"
  • Guarda loro si uniscono e bastone

Una volta che riesco a capire come fare questo, posso passare con il codice più complicato che sto cercando di scrivere (non è questo il problema). Sto semplicemente bloccato su dove cominciare. Ho cercato e cercato, ma non riesco a trovare una risposta definitiva, la documentazione è scarsa e difficile da afferrare.

Se questo è sicuramente non è possibile o non vale la pena di tentare in SolidWorks, allora questo è una risposta accettabile. Non avrei mai scelto SolidWorks se mi è stato lasciato libero di scegliere la piattaforma, ma è stato scelto per me.

Modifica
Sembra di classe IDDMActionReactionForce di COSMOSMotion API è quello che stavo cercando. Qualcuno mi può indicare un esempio di utilizzo per definire una forza personalizzato tra due oggetti?

È stato utile?

Soluzione 2

Dopo tanto cercare, la mia conclusione è SolidWorks non è la piattaforma appropriata per questo. Essa non consente di collegare nei suoi calcoli fisici interni e l'oggetto Forza ho parlato è troppo inefficiente per il problema di cui avevo bisogno per modellare. Teoricamente, funzionerà per portare due cubi insieme lungo SolidWorks laterali costruito in gravità / collisione elementi di simulazione rilevamento ma quando si confronta con un problema di n-corpo, era evidente che non è stato fatto per questo.

Altri suggerimenti

Non riesco a parlare di SolidWorks, quindi la mia risposta potrebbe essere irrilevante -. Ma io ho un software ray-tracing utilizzato per modellare sistemi dinamici

Ho il mio caso, stavo simulando le circostanze delle eclissi lunari e solari. Il software di ray-tracing (POVRay) si prese cura di generare un'immagine della scena tra cui il Sole, la Terra e la Luna, ma ho dovuto calcolare le posizioni dei vari organi per ogni frame dell'animazione .

Ho il sospetto che questo può essere il caso di modellazione dinamica elettromagnetiche, e si dovranno calcolare le posizioni dei corpi coinvolti a intervalli, in modo che Solidworks renderà le quinte di un'animazione.

I può essere tutto sbagliato le funzionalità di SolidWorks, quindi vi auguro buona fortuna.

Ero tentato di dire che "è impossibile", perché lei ha detto che sarebbe "una risposta accettabile", ma sarebbe troppo facile.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top